Central Air Unit Replacement in Kansas City, MO
Central air unit replacement services involve removing an existing air conditioning system and installing a new, more efficient model to ensure proper cooling and comfort during warmer months. These projects typically include evaluating the current system, selecting an appropriate replacement, and handling the installation process to optimize performance and energy use. Homeowners often seek this service when their current unit is outdated, frequently breaking down, or no longer providing adequate cooling, especially during peak summer periods.
Before requesting a central air unit replacement, property owners usually want to understand the size and capacity of the new system needed for their home, as well as the installation process and any necessary modifications to existing ductwork. It’s also common to inquire about the expected lifespan of the new unit, energy efficiency features, and potential impacts on utility bills. Having these details helps ensure the replacement aligns with the home's cooling needs and provides reliable comfort throughout the warmer months.

Central Air Unit Replacement Questions
When is it time to replace a central air unit? Replacement is recommended when the unit is frequently breaking down, running inefficiently, or no longer effectively cooling the space.
What are common signs indicating a central air unit needs replacement? Signs include unusual noises, rising energy bills, inconsistent cooling, or the presence of leaks or refrigerant issues.
How does a new central air unit improve home comfort? A new system provides more reliable cooling, improves energy efficiency, and helps maintain consistent indoor temperatures.
What should property owners consider when choosing a replacement unit? Consider the size of the space, energy efficiency ratings, and compatibility with existing ductwork for optimal performance.
